more-in Three more assault incidents were reported in Dakshina Kannada on Tuesday. In the first incident at Uppinangady, Abdul Rehman (35), a driver of a mini lorry transporting cooking gas, was assaulted and robbed of ? 10,000 in cash in the morning. The police said that Abdul Rehman, a resident of Mata village, left for work at 5.30 a.m. Near Medarabettu, Rehman stopped his vehicle as a van came too close to his. This resulted in a heated exchange of words between Rehman and the van driver. The latter damaged the wind-shield of the mini lorry and reportedly dragged Rehman out of the vehicle. The van driver rained blows on him and left the place after robbing Rehman of ? 10,000 in cash. The injured Rehman has been admitted to a private hospital. The Uppinangady police have registered a case of robbery and assault. In the second incident near Ullal in the noon, van driver Austin (27) was assaulted reportedly by those in a car at Azad Nagar in Mastikatte as the former did not give way for the car driver to overtake. The Ullal police said that Austin was carrying some material to a place in Mastikatte in his van and a car was following it. At a point, the car driver honked seeking way to overtake. Austin could not give way as there was another vehicle in front of his. He, therefore, indicated to the car driver to slow down. Irked by Austin’s conduct, the car driver and three others in it came out of their vehicle and assaulted Austin. One of them attacked Austin with a sharp weapon causing injury in his right hand. The police said that a case of assault has been registered. They have launched a search for the assailants. In the third incident reported in the Bajpe police limits on Monday night, Aboobacker Siddiq (32), a lorry helper, was reportedly assaulted by a few persons near Yedapadavu Junction. In a complaint to the Bajpe police, Siddiq said that two motorcycle-borne men hit him while he was walking past the Vivekananda School at Yedapadavu Junction around 7.30 p.m. The assailants quickly left the place. Siddiq was admitted to a private hospital, the police said. The police said that they have made inquiries and also checked the footage of closed circuit television cameras in the area and have found no instances of any assault near Yedapadavu Junction. The police inquired the lorry driver who reported that he dropped Siddiq 5 km ahead of Yedapadavu Junction. The police said that they are also making inquiries about the assault at the place where Siddiq got off the lorry.
